**Position Overview**:We are seeking a creative and driven Human Resources Professional to join our team as a People & Talent Coordinator Our goal is to create legendary and memorable experiences for our team and members The People & Talent Coordinator is responsible for planning and executing our recruitment, onboarding, and retention strategies that foster a fun, positive, and inclusive community environment for our team and members. The People & Talent Coordinator will own the full cycle recruitment of a broad portfolio of in club and office positions. This position will also support other areas of Human Resources, including in club training and development, payroll, employee investigations, benefits, performance reviews, onboarding and offboarding, rewards and recognition, and health & safety.

This position offers a hybrid work model. We have an anchor day in our office in Cambridge one day per week. You will also spend 2-3 days per week in club visits. The remaining 1-2 days can be spent working remotely in a home office. Our clubs are primarily located in the GTA (Brampton, Mississauga, Oakville) and Southwestern Ontario (London, Windsor, Sarnia). Regular travel to all clubs is required and reliable transportation is essential for success in this position. Some overnight travel will also be required.
